The overall acceptance rate for Boston College was reported as 27.2% in Fall 2020 with over 35,600 college applications submitted to BC. This figure translates into the fact that out of 100 applicants willing to take admission at the school, 27 are admitted. Candidates are required to apply to one of the University's four undergraduate academic divisions: the Morrissey College of Arts and Sciences, Carroll School of Management, Lynch School of Education and Human Development, or Connell School of Nursing. 288 Niche users give it an average review of 3.9 stars. The middle 50% of students admitted to Boston College received a composite ACT score between 31 and 34, while 25% scored above 34 and 25% scored below 31. from students, alumni, staff and others. Both Early Decision and Regular Decision candidates are eligible for Presidential Scholarship consideration as long as they meet the November 1 priority scholarship deadline.
